Officine Panerai CAD–PLM–CAM Specialist (Creo & Windchill)
Officine Panerai is a luxury watchmaker that blends Italian design heritage with Swiss watchmaking precision. As part of the Richemont Group, the brand is recognized for its technical excellence, artisanal craftsmanship and innovation in high-end horology.
- Act as the internal reference and subject-matter expert for CAD (Creo), PLM (Windchill) and CAM processes across R&D, prototyping and production.
- Administer and configure Windchill to support product data lifecycle, change control, release processes and BOM management.
- Develop, maintain and enforce CAD standards, templates and libraries in Creo to ensure design consistency and manufacturability.
- Support CAM programming and process integration to translate CAD models into accurate machining outputs; collaborate with workshops to optimize toolpaths and machine setups.
- Provide second- and third-line user support, troubleshooting, and training for engineers and technicians on Creo and Windchill best practices.
- Lead or contribute to PLM/CAD/CAM-related projects including system upgrades, integrations (PDM/ERP), and automation of repetitive workflows.
- Ensure data integrity, version control and compliance with documentation and regulatory requirements for watch component design data.
- Liaise with cross-functional teams (engineering, quality, procurement, production) to streamline product development and handover to manufacturing.
- Bachelor’s degree or equivalent diploma in Mechanical Engineering, Industrial Engineering, Manufacturing Technology or related discipline.
- Proven hands-on experience administering or acting as a power user for Creo and Windchill in an industrial environment.
- Solid understanding of CAD/CAM workflows, CNC machining processes, and practical manufacturability for high-precision components.
- Experience implementing PLM processes (change management, ECO/ECR, BOM structures) and configuring PDM systems.
- Strong analytical and problem-solving abilities, with proven experience in user training and cross-functional stakeholder management.
- Creo
- Windchill
- PLM
- CAD
- CAM
- PDM
- BOM management
- CAD standards and template development
- Data governance and release management
Several years of professional experience working with CAD and PLM systems, including direct experience with Creo and Windchill; demonstrated involvement in CAM support or close collaboration with manufacturing teams. Experience in precision manufacturing or watchmaking is advantageous.
Bachelor's degree or technical diploma in Mechanical Engineering, Industrial Engineering, Manufacturing Technology or equivalent.
This position is listed in Neuchâtel, Neuchâtel, in Switzerland. Officine Panerai is actively recruiting for this and 614 other open jobs in Switzerland.
The workplace combines the artisanal values of haute horology with rigorous engineering and process discipline. Teams operate in a highly collaborative, detail-oriented environment where technical excellence and respect for craftsmanship underpin product development.
Officine Panerai Careers
-
Today
-
Today
-
Today
-
Today
-
Today
-
Today
-
Today
-
Today
-
Today
-
Today
Continue Your Search
We invite you to review more currently available roles: